Picking the Right Cat Flap
Before diving into the installation process, it's vital to pick the right cat flap for your requirements. Consider the following elements:
Size: Cat flaps come in different sizes to accommodate various breeds and door types. Measure your door and your cat to ensure a comfy fit.Material: Choose from plastic, metal, or magnetic flaps, each with its own advantages and downsides.Insulation: Consider a cat flap with built-in insulation to lessen heat loss and prevent drafts.Security: Opt for a flap with a safe and secure locking system to avoid unwanted visitors.
Some popular types of cat flaps consist of:
Manual cat flaps: Simple, cost-efficient, and easy to install.Magnetic cat flaps: Provide a more protected seal and can be set to open and close immediately.Electronic cat flaps: Feature advanced features such as microchip recognition and programmable timers.
Tools and Materials Needed
To guarantee an effective installation, collect the following tools and materials:
Cat flap: The real flap and its elements, such as screws, hinges, and a lock.Drill and bits: For making holes and driving screws.Saw or craft knife: For cutting through doors or walls.Sandpaper: For smoothing out the installation area.Sealant: For filling spaces and ensuring a weather-tight seal.Weatherproofing products: Such as foam tape or weatherstripping.
Step-by-Step Installation Guide
Select the installation place: Ideally, the commercial cat flap fitting flap ought to be set up in a door or wall that supplies direct access to the outdoors.Procedure and mark the door: Use a pencil to mark the center point of the cat flap on the door.Cut a hole: Use a saw or craft knife to produce a hole in the door, following the maker's standards for size and shape.Attach the cat flap: Use screws and hinges to secure the cat flap to the door, making sure proper positioning and a smooth operation.Add a lock: Install the lock according to the maker's directions, making certain it's safe and tamper-proof.Weatherproof the area: Apply sealant and weatherproofing products to avoid drafts and moisture entry.Test the cat flap: Ensure the flap opens and closes smoothly, and the lock is operating properly.
Tips and Considerations
Choose the right door: Avoid installing a cat flap in a door that's exposed to severe weather conditions or extreme wear and tear.Consider the cat's convenience: Position the cat flap at a comfy height for your cat, and ensure the surrounding area is clear of obstacles.Protect the flap: Regularly check and keep the cat flap's locking system to prevent unwanted visitors.Keep it clean: Regularly clean the cat flap to prevent dirt and debris buildup.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I set up a cat flap in a wall?A: Yes, however it may need extra products and labor to produce a suitable opening.Q: Can I utilize a cat flap in a double-glazed door?A: Yes, however you might need to consult a professional to guarantee a correct installation.Q: How do I avoid other animals from going into through the cat flap?A: Use a protected lock, and consider including a magnetic or electronic system to control access.Q: Can I set up a cat flap myself?A: Yes, but if you're not comfy with DIY tasks or not sure about the installation, consider seeking advice from a professional.
